Figure 1 Illustrations of the surgical procedures and technique. (A) An anchor was inserted in the medial cuneiform and the suture was passed through from the medial cuneiform to the lateral side of the base of the second metatarsal. (B). The suture was passed through the dorsal side of foot. (C, D) The suture was passed through another anchor, tightened, and compressed into the intermediate cuneiform. MC – medial cuneiform; BSI – blue suture with InternalBrace; BAI – suture anchor with InternalBrace; EPLT – extensor pollicis longus tendon; AVDF – arteriovenous dorsal foot; HIC – the hole of intermediate cuneiform; IC – intermediate cuneiform; SBAV – the suture crosses between the bone and the arteriovenous dorsal foot.
